Output 4635252101b5f3c5c260443258040e04450406bbd76f3a9f604c8c695d43de80:3

value
103327
script pubkey
OP_0 OP_PUSHBYTES_20 0c9cc97fb7037e7b73989b797950ea88988edbbd
address
bc1qpjwvjlahqdl8kuucnduhj5823zvgakaaq7gcwm
transaction
4635252101b5f3c5c260443258040e04450406bbd76f3a9f604c8c695d43de80
confirmations
173243
spent
true